Sharks of numerous species don’t necessarily hunt at the same time, scientists have figured out.

Researchers tagged 172 sharks — tigers, bulls, sandbars, blacktips, mammoth hammerheads and scalloped hammerheads — in the Gulf of Mexico and tracked their movements.

It became out that size does subject: Tigers, being the splendid sharks who also have a tendency to kill smaller sharks, hunted whenever they felt discover it irresistible, but many times for the interval of noon. The total numerous shark species hunted at numerous instances, be it early in the morning, behind afternoon or after darkish.
